The first-carrier-issuing-the-ticket "rule" has only applied to tickets bought using the online tool; it was never a rule enforced by the airlines when the ticket was booked manually.
It was never a rule, just a limitation on the online tool to make programming it easier. However, some agents think it is a rule and I've been told at least once to go talk to another airline.
I contacted CX about a quote for a DAS13 (CBR-SYD-NRT-ITM-NRT-HKG-SIN-MEL), CX had the flights that touched HKG, QF/JL had the rest. The agent told me to go talk to QF since they had the first flight. They relented and gave the quote when I started reading the fare rules to them.
